Calling for re-evaluation of law

Description
Calling for re-evaluation of law involves initiating formal reviews of existing legal frameworks to address outdated, unjust, or ineffective statutes. This strategy seeks to identify and remedy legal shortcomings by advocating for amendments, repeals, or new legislation. Its practical intent is to ensure laws remain relevant, equitable, and responsive to societal needs, thereby resolving specific issues such as legal ambiguities, social injustices, or regulatory gaps that hinder effective governance and protection of rights.
